对于当前的项目,我计划使用 Dask 合并两个非常大的 CSV 文件,作为 Pandas 的替代方案。我已经彻底安装了 Dask pip install "dask[dataframe]"
。
当运行import dask.dataframe as dd
时,我收到反馈ModuleNotFoundError: No module named 'dask.dataframe'; “dask”不是一个包
。
一些用户似乎遇到了同样的问题,并建议通过 Conda 安装该模块,但这对我的情况也没有帮助。
找不到模块的原因是什么?
最佳答案
正如用户 John Gordon 提到的,错误通知的原因是同一文件夹中的一个文件名为 dask.py
。重命名文件在几秒钟内解决了问题。
作为一般规则/结论:建议不要使用与 Python 模块直接相关的 .py 文件名。
关于python - 模块未找到错误: No module named 'dask.dataframe' ; 'dask' is not a package,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/63452968/